虚拟专用服务器已成为现代网络架构中不可或缺的基础设施组件。它

2分钟阅读
2026-03-12
2,194

虚拟专用服务器已成为现代网络架构中不可或缺的基础设施组件。它不仅为个人开发者和初创公司提供了经济高效的解决方案,也是企业实现数字化转型、业务扩展和系统稳定的关键基石。其核心价值在于将物理服务器的强大功能,通过虚拟化技术进行分割与分发,让用户能够以较低的成本获得独立的、可定制的、具备完整管理员权限的计算资源。

与传统的共享主机不同,虚拟专用服务器提供了一个隔离的、安全的操作环境。用户在享受类似独立服务器的高控制权的同时,无需承担购置和维护物理硬件的巨额开销及复杂管理任务。技术的迭代,特别是KVM、Xen等虚拟化方案的成熟,以及固态硬盘和高速网络的普及,使得虚拟专用服务器的性能与可靠性达到了全新的高度。

虚拟专用服务器的主要类型

虚拟专用服务器的分类主要依据其背后的虚拟化技术和管理模式,不同类型的服务器在性能、隔离性和控制粒度上各有千秋。

推荐阅读 VPS主机:零基础新手到高手的终极选择与配置指南

基于虚拟化技术的分类

从技术底层来看,主要的虚拟专用服务器类型包括基于KVM、Xen、OpenVZ/LXC以及VMware等方案。其中,KVM是一种基于Linux内核的完全虚拟化解决方案,它允许用户运行未经修改的Windows或Linux镜像,提供了近乎裸机的性能体验和绝对的资源隔离,是目前市场上中高端虚拟专用服务器的首选技术。Xen则分为半虚拟化和完全虚拟化两种模式,历史悠久,在稳定性和安全性方面有深厚的积累。

HostArmadaVPS主机
Cloud SSD/NVMe + 多层缓存提速,24/7/365 支持,响应时间明确,VPS 7 天 退款保证,现在付款享受 5折优惠

另一种常见类型是基于容器技术的虚拟专用服务器,例如OpenVZ或其现代后继者LXC。这类方案在操作系统级别进行虚拟化,所有容器共享宿主机内核,因此在资源效率上极高,开销极低,性能表现也非常出色。但其缺点在于隔离性相对较弱,用户通常无法自由修改内核参数或使用特定的内核模块。

基于管理模式的分类

根据服务的自动化程度和管理责任划分,虚拟专用服务器可分为非托管型、半托管型和全托管型。非托管型虚拟专用服务器为用户提供了基础的操作系统环境,后续所有的系统维护、安全加固、软件安装、备份设置等任务均由用户自行负责。这需要用户具备较强的技术能力,但同时也给予了最大的灵活性。

半托管服务则会提供基础的监控、备份和操作系统层面的故障排除支持。而全托管型虚拟专用服务器则将技术管理的重任完全转移给服务提供商,从硬件维护、网络安全到应用部署和性能优化,都由专业团队打理。用户只需专注于自己的核心业务逻辑,尤其适合资源有限或对运维不熟悉的团队。

如何选择适合的虚拟专用服务器

面对市场上琳琅满目的虚拟专用服务器提供商和配置方案,做出明智的选择需要综合评估多个关键因素,以确保资源投入能够精准匹配业务需求,并带来长期稳定的价值。

推荐阅读 什么是 VPS 主机

明确需求与评估关键硬件参数

首先,必须清晰定义自身需求。是用于搭建个人博客、电子商务网站、应用程序后盾、游戏服务器,还是进行开发测试?不同的应用场景对计算资源的需求千差万别。例如,一个高流量的动态网站可能对CPU处理能力、内存容量和固态硬盘的I/O性能有较高要求;而一个存储大量媒体文件的站点则需要更大的磁盘空间和充足的网络带宽。

核心硬件参数评估包括:CPU的核心数量与主频,这决定了服务器的并行处理能力;内存的总量和类型,它直接影响同时能处理的任务数量和响应速度;存储空间的大小和介质,固态硬盘在读写速度上远超传统机械硬盘,能显著提升系统及应用的加载性能;网络带宽的大小和对国际连接的优化程度(如CN2 GIA线路对于中国大陆用户访问至关重要)同样不可或缺。

关注服务商的信誉与支持

技术规格之外,服务商的信誉和客户支持质量是虚拟专用服务器稳定运行的根本保障。在做出决定前,应详细研究服务商在业内的口碑、运营历史、用户评价以及服务水平协议中对在线时间的承诺(如99.9%或更高)。一个响应迅速、专业高效的技术支持团队,在面临突发故障或安全事件时,能起到力挽狂澜的作用。

Bluehost VPS主机
Bluehost VPS主机
新一代 AMD EPYC 处理器,DDR5 内存 + NVMe SSD 存储,24/7 在线聊天与电话支持
最高 32% 优惠
访问Bluehost VPS主机 →
UltaHost VPS主机
UltaHost VPS主机
AMD EPYC CPU,99.99% 正常运行时间 保证,30天退款保证
限时 9 折优惠
访问UltaHost VPS主机 →

此外,数据中心的地理位置会显著影响网站的访问延迟。通常建议选择靠近目标用户群的数据中心。对于业务覆盖全球的用户,可以考虑具备多个数据中心可供选择的提供商,或利用内容分发网络来优化全球访问体验。最后,灵活的资源配置选项和透明的升级路径,能够确保您的虚拟专用服务器可以随着业务的增长而平滑扩展。

虚拟专用服务器的核心应用场景

虚拟专用服务器的灵活性使其能够胜任多样化的网络任务,从个人项目到企业级应用,几乎无所不包。

网站与应用程序托管

这是虚拟专用服务器最基础也是最广泛的应用。无论是使用WordPress、Joomla等内容管理系统搭建的博客和公司官网,还是基于Laravel、Django等框架开发的复杂Web应用程序,虚拟专用服务器都能提供一个自主可控的部署环境。用户可以根据应用需求自由安装所需的Web服务器软件、数据库和编程语言环境,并通过配置实现最佳性能和安全策略。

推荐阅读 VPS主机终极指南:从入门到精通,挑选与搭建全攻略

开发测试与部署环境

对于开发者和技术团队而言,虚拟专用服务器是理想的开发、测试和暂存环境。团队成员可以在一个与生产环境高度一致的远程服务器上进行协作开发、功能测试和集成测试,而不会干扰本地机器配置或影响线上服务的稳定运行。尤其是在进行需要特定系统配置或依赖复杂服务栈的项目时,虚拟专用服务器的价值更加凸显。

游戏服务器与通信服务

多人在线游戏的爱好者或社区组织者,可以租用虚拟专用服务器来搭建《我的世界》、《反恐精英:全球攻势》等游戏的私人服务器,完全掌控游戏规则、模组和访问权限。此外,虚拟专用服务器也常用于部署团队语音通信服务(如Mumble、TeamSpeak)或自建的虚拟专用网络服务,后者在保护网络隐私和访问特定网络资源方面作用显著。

hosting.comVPS主机
免费SSL、Cloudflare CDN、WAF,99.9%的正常运行时间 SLA,AMD EPYC™ CPU 和 NVMe 存储,最高优惠 50%

数据备份与私有云存储

利用虚拟专用服务器的大容量存储空间,用户可以搭建自动化的远程备份系统,定期将本地重要数据同步到云端,防范硬件损坏或数据丢失的风险。更进一步,可以部署Nextcloud、ownCloud等私有云盘软件,构建一个完全由自己掌控的、功能不逊于公有云服务的文件同步与分享平台,兼具了便利性与数据私密性。

优化与安全配置指南

在成功部署虚拟专用服务器后,进行系统性的优化与安全加固是保障其长期稳定、高效运行的必要步骤。

系统性能优化实践

性能优化的第一步通常从更新系统软件包和内核开始,以获取最新的性能改进和安全补丁。针对Web服务器,可以对Nginx或Apache进行针对性调优,例如调整工作进程数量、连接超时设置、启用Gzip压缩和浏览器缓存等,以提升网页加载速度。数据库方面,需根据内存大小和业务特点(读写比例)优化MySQL或PostgreSQL的配置参数。

定期清理不必要的文件、日志以及软件包缓存可以释放宝贵的磁盘空间。启用交换分区可以在物理内存耗尽时提供缓冲,防止应用程序崩溃,但需要注意交换分区速度远低于内存。对于高I/O需求的场景,确保文件系统的挂载选项已针对固态硬盘优化(如使用noatime选项)。

关键安全防护措施

安全防护必须作为虚拟专用服务器管理的重中之重。基础措施包括:立即修改默认的SSH端口,禁用root用户的直接SSH登录,转而使用密钥认证而非密码登录。配置防火墙工具,如iptablesufw,只开放必要的服务端口(如80,443,自定义SSH端口),并屏蔽所有其他入站连接。

及时建立自动化的系统更新机制,确保安全补丁能够第一时间被应用。安装并配置入侵检测系统、防暴力破解工具,并定期查看系统日志,监控异常登录尝试和可疑活动。对于托管网站的服务器,还应部署Web应用防火墙、为应用程序安装安全插件,并定期使用SSL/TLS证书加密所有数据传输。

总结

总而言之,虚拟专用服务器以其在控制力、性能、成本与可扩展性之间取得的卓越平衡,成为了构建现代网络服务的主流选择。从基础的网站托管到复杂的应用开发,从游戏社区到私有云存储,其应用范围极其广泛。成功利用虚拟专用服务器的关键在于:根据具体的技术需求和业务目标,审慎选择适合的技术类型、硬件配置和信誉良好的服务提供商,并在部署后持续进行系统性能优化与全方位安全加固。通过遵循这些最佳实践,无论是技术爱好者还是企业,都能充分发挥虚拟专用服务器的强大潜力,为在线业务奠定坚实可靠的基础。

FAQ 常见问题

虚拟专用服务器与云服务器有何区别?

虚拟专用服务器通常是将一台独立的物理服务器通过虚拟化技术划分为多个独立的虚拟服务器,资源分配相对固定,适合需求稳定或对性能一致性要求高的场景。

云服务器则构建在更庞大的集群之上,资源池化程度更高,用户可以随时弹性地按需调配计算、存储和网络资源,并且通常按实际使用量计费。它在应对流量突发和业务快速伸缩方面更具优势,架构也天生具备更高的可用性。

新手应该选择哪个操作系统?

对于没有特殊需求的初学者,我们通常推荐选择一个稳定的、长期支持的Linux发行版,例如Ubuntu LTS版或CentOS Stream。它们拥有庞大的用户社区、丰富的教学文档和软件支持,遇到问题时更容易找到解决方案。图形化桌面环境并非服务器所必需,从命令行开始学习能让你更深入地理解和控制系统。

如果您的应用程序必须是基于Windows技术栈开发的(如.NET框架),那么则需选择Windows Server版本,但这通常意味着更高的授权费用和不同的管理方式。

如何判断我的虚拟专用服务器资源是否够用?

您可以通过系统自带的监控工具来观察资源使用情况。使用命令如tophtop查看实时的CPU和内存占用;使用df -h检查磁盘空间使用率;使用iftopnethogs监控网络流量。

当CPU使用率持续高于80%、内存使用接近饱和并频繁使用交换分区、磁盘I/O等待时间过长,或每月带宽在高峰期前就已耗尽时,通常就是需要考虑升级配置的明确信号。许多控制面板也提供直观的资源使用图表。

虚拟专用服务器的数据会自动备份吗?

这完全取决于您选择的服务类型和您的自主配置。绝大多数非托管或基础托管型虚拟专用服务器不会自动为您的数据提供备份。备份是用户自身的责任。

强烈建议您立即建立自己的备份策略,可以结合定时任务,使用rsyncscp等工具将关键数据同步到另一台服务器或对象存储服务,并定期测试备份的完整性和可恢复性。部分服务商会提供收费的自动备份服务,可以作为额外保障。